Today, that barrier is significantly lowered. Snowflake, through a new strategic OneGov agreement made available via the U.S. General Services Administration (GSA), will make it easier for federal agencies to leverage its AI Data Cloud to enhance mission effectiveness. Carahsoft, acting as the trusted government IT solutions provider, partnered with Snowflake to offer its data cloud through Carahsoft’s GSA MAS. This expands access for federal agencies with accessible, pre-negotiated pricing, simplifying procurement and accelerating modernization timelines. ## Clearing the path for mission success The primary goal is to remove friction slowing digital transformation. Under this agreement, new U.S. federal Snowflake customers will receive substantial discounts on the AI Data Cloud, including up to 50% reduced compute costs. This allows agencies to better allocate resources, make faster decisions, and focus on serving their communities. As GSA Administrator Edward C. Data often resides in isolated systems, making secure sharing complex and time-consuming. Snowflake’s AI Data Cloud addresses this by providing a unified, governed platform that eliminates many technical complexities of traditional data systems. Key benefits include secure data sharing across the federal ecosystem, enabling live, governed data connections. This directly supports modern data-sharing practices and the administration’s AI initiatives. Federal agencies need to act on data, not just store it. Snowflake’s AI Data Cloud supports diverse workloads, data warehousing, engineering, science, and AI, on a single, scalable platform. Snowflake's pricing allows compute to scale automatically, so agencies pay only for what they need, when they need it. Snowflake operates with built-in governance and supports stringent standards, including deployments authorized for FedRAMP High and the Department of Defense's Risk Management Framework (RMF) Impact Level 5. This streamlined acquisition process via OneGov will accelerate the adoption of data-driven strategies across the federal landscape. It provides agencies an effective pathway to deliver on the administration’s AI Action Plan and regulatory mandates for secure, enterprise commercial solutions and multicloud interoperability.
